About Free Horizon Montessori

Free Horizon Montessori is a public elementary school located in Golden, Colorado. Serving preschool through eighth grade students, the school has an enrollment of 373 students and maintains a student-teacher ratio of 17:1 with 22 full-time equivalent teachers. The campus is situated in a large suburban area within Jefferson County.

While Free Horizon Montessori’s MySchoolScout rating stands at 4.9 out of 10, indicating room for improvement, the school remains dedicated to providing a nurturing and personalized educational experience. With an academic score of 5.5 out of 10, students show proficiency levels in ELA/Reading at 43% and Math at 28%, highlighting areas where further growth is needed. Free Horizon Montessori’s setting offers a supportive suburban community that encourages parental involvement and collaboration with local resources to enhance student learning experiences.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Free Horizon Montessori has a median household income of $112,444. It is a well-educated community where 57%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$748,800, with a median rent of $1,868/month. The local poverty rate of 9.3%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 24 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
